Prime Minister Imran Khan arrived in Washington DC, USA

The Prime Minister was received by Senior Officials of US State Department, Foreign Minister Shah Mahmood Qureshi and Ambassador of Pakistan to USA Dr. Asad M. Khan.

The Prime Minister is accompanied by Adviser to PM on Commerce Mr. Abdul Razzaq Dawood and Foreign Secretary Mr. Sohail Mehmood.
